Development of MQYY: A 90-mm NbTi Double Aperture Quadrupole Magnet for HL-LHC / Felice, Helene (IRFU, Saclay) ; Segreti, Michel (IRFU, Saclay) ; Simon, Damien (IRFU, Saclay) ; Rifflet, Jean Michel (IRFU, Saclay) ; Gheller, Jean Marc (IRFU, Saclay) ; Bouziat, Denis (IRFU, Saclay) ; Madur, Arnaud (IRFU, Saclay) ; Graffin, Patrick (IRFU, Saclay ; IRFU, Saclay, DACM) ; Salvador, Henri (IRFU, Saclay ; IRFU, Saclay, DACM) ; Millot, Jean Francois (IRFU, Saclay ; IRFU, Saclay, DACM) et al.
In the context of the HL-LHC project, a NbTi double aperture quadrupole magnet called MQYY is being developed. This 90-mm-aperture quadrupole magnet has a magnetic length of 3.67 m and an operating gradient of 120 T/m at 1.9 K. [...]

Magnetic measurements and analysis of the first 11-T Nb$_3$ Sn 2-in-1 model for HL-LHC / Fiscarelli, Lucio (CERN) ; Izquierdo Bermudez, Susana (CERN) ; Dunkel, Olaf (CERN) ; Russenschuck, Stephan (CERN) ; Savary, Frederic (CERN) ; Willering, Gerard (CERN)
In the framework of the High-Luminosity upgrade of the Large Hadron Collider, the design and development of new magnets, relying on Nb$_{3}$Sn superconducting cables, is progressing. In particular, a double-aperture dipole, with a bore diameter of 60 mm and a central field of 11 T, is required for the replacement of some Nb-Ti dipoles in the dispersion suppressor areas. [...]

Testing of the Superconducting Magnets for the FAIR Project / Mierau, Anna (Darmstadt, GSI) ; Schnizer, Pierre (Darmstadt, GSI) ; Fischer, Egbert (Darmstadt, GSI) ; Mueller, Hans (Darmstadt, GSI) ; Khodzhibagiyan, Hamlet (Dubna, JINR) ; Kostromin, Sergey (Dubna, JINR) ; Serio, Luigi (CERN) ; Russenschuck, Stephan (CERN) ; Dunkel, Olaf (CERN)
The Facility for Antiproton and Ion Research (FAIR) is currently being constructed at GSI Darmstadt. Around 500 superconducting magnets are being procured for the heavy ion synchrotron SIS100, and around 180 are being procured for the Super Fragment Separator (Super-FRS). [...]
